Mikael Johanssen is a synthwave musician based in Thessaloniki, Greece. With a career spanning over 5 years, their sound blends electronic ambient with neo-folk influences, creating a distinctive sonic palette that has been described as "deeply atmospheric and emotionally resonant."

Their latest work continues to push the boundaries of synthwave, incorporating elements of neo-folk and field recordings from Thessaloniki, Greece.
